Is Lititz a Good Place to Live?

B+
3.7 / 5.0 — Good
Based on economy, affordability, safety, and education metrics compared to national averages.

Economy & Jobs

Lititz residents earn a median household income of $82,861 , which is 10% above the national average of $75,149. Per capita income is $43,376. The unemployment rate stands at 1.1% (69% below the U.S. rate of 3.6%). 0.6% of residents live below the poverty line. The area is home to 14,605 business establishments, including 1,139 restaurants.

Housing & Cost of Living

The median home value in Lititz is $264,600 , 6% below the national median of $281,900. Zillow estimates the typical home at $448,603. Median rent is $1,207/month, with 30.7% of renters spending more than 30% of income on housing. The cost of living index is 97.6 (100 = national average). The median home was built in 1963.

Safety & Crime

Lititz reports 85 violent crimes per 100,000 residents , which is 78% below the national average of 380/100K. Property crime is 575/100K. The murder rate is 0.0/100K.

Education

38.3% of adults in Lititz hold a bachelor's degree or higher (14% above the national average). 96.1% have completed high school. Local schools score 6.2/10 in standardized testing.

Climate & Weather

Lititz has an average annual temperature of 53°F (12°C). Winters average 31°F in January while summers reach 75°F in July. The area gets 275 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 42.1 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 40.
